Version 1.310 (7 November 2007)

    *  The current folder position is now preserved when reading and replying to email.
    * When using an IMAP inbox, the read and special flags are now fetched from and updated on the IMAP server, rather than in a separate file kept by Virtualmin. This allows them to be synced with other IMAP clients like Thunderbird and Outlook.
    * Many improvements to the way attachments are displayed when reading or forwarding mail, such as use of tables, links to download and view, and nicer type descriptions.
    * When replying to or forwarding an HTML message with inline images, they are properly preserved in the new email.
    * Added Preferences page options to move email to the inbox when whitelisting or reporting a non-spam.
    * Added links to download all attachments from a message as a ZIP file, and to show all attached images on a single page as a slideshow.
    * Embedded images from Outlook are properly displayed.
    * Added a Preferences page option to control the wrapping of text messages.
    * Added links to select read, unread and special messages.
    * Added global configuration settings to use MySQL, PostgreSQL or LDAP backends for storing SpamAssassin preferences.
